These knives are amazingly light and sharp - add a few to your current steel knife set and I gaurantee you will use one every meal - the light weight and ergonomic shape and balance point really reduce fatigue on those chore-some meals (stew! choppity chop chop!) and just the speed and convenience of a knife that is always as sharp as you need it to be will make it worth your while. I would suggest starting with the paring knife or utility size and then move up to the chef's knife or nakiri when you're fully convinced.

Product Description:
These Kyocera Ceramic knives are a unique alternative to metal-based versions with a resin handle for a highly controlled grip. Unlike a forged metal blade, which is soft and susceptible to chemical corrosion, the Kyocera zirconium oxide blade resists this wear and holds its edge for months to years without sharpening. It holds its edge much longer than steel and lasts many months or years without sharpening. Stain and rust-resistant, the blade is impervious to the food acids, which discolor steel products and no metallic taste or smell will be absorbed your food from the knife. A non-stick ceramic surface makes for easy cleanup and a lightweight and perfect balance make it a pleasure to use. What more could you ask for, especially since Kyocera knives come with a five year limited warranty against breakage (does not cover cutting bones, prying or flexing).
